520 _a "Whether you’re eyeing a specific leadership role, hoping to advance your skills, or simply looking to broaden your professional network, you need to find someone who can help. Wait for a senior manager to come looking for you—and you’ll probably be waiting forever. Instead, you need to find the mentoring that will help you achieve your goals. Managed correctly, mentoring is a powerful and efficient tool for moving up. The HBR Guide to Getting the Mentoring You Need will help you get it right. You’ll learn how to: • Find new ways to stand out in your organization• Set clear and realistic development goals• Identify and build relationships with influential sponsors• Give back and bring value to mentors and senior advisers• Evaluate your progress in reaching your professional goals" -Publisher's description.
